
This nonfiction chapter book offers an engaging look into the world of wildfires and the dedicated individuals who combat them. Through detailed text and compelling photographs, it covers the training, equipment, and on-the-ground experiences of wildfire fighters. It also delves into the important role of fire ecology, explaining how controlled burns can be beneficial for ecosystems. Ideal for children aged 4-11, it provides a balanced perspective on fire as both a destructive force and a natural process, fostering an appreciation for nature and public service.
